Mature Height of Species

Average Height Ranges 🌳

Rhizophora species, commonly known as red mangroves, typically reach impressive heights. On average, these trees grow between 20 to 30 meters (65 to 98 feet), with many individuals falling within the 20 to 25 meters (65 to 82 feet) range.

However, under optimal conditions, some can stretch up to 30 meters (98 feet). This remarkable growth makes them a vital part of coastal ecosystems.

Factors Influencing Height πŸ“

Several factors play a crucial role in determining the height of Rhizophora species. Genetic factors are significant, as each species has its unique growth potential.

Environmental influences also matter greatly. Soil quality, salinity levels, and water availability can either promote or hinder growth. For instance, nutrient-rich soils and moderate salinity levels typically encourage taller trees, while extreme conditions may stunt their development.

Mature Width and Spread

Average Width Measurements 🌳

The mature width of Rhizophora species is impressive, often exceeding 10 meters (33 feet). Some specific species can spread up to 12 meters (39 feet), with the widest reaching an astounding 15 meters (49 feet).

Importance of Width 🌊

The width of these mangroves plays a crucial role in shoreline stabilization. Their expansive root systems help prevent erosion and create vital habitats for various marine life.

Additionally, a healthy width contributes significantly to the overall health of the mangrove ecosystem. This not only supports biodiversity but also enhances the resilience of coastal areas against storms and rising sea levels.

Growth Rate

Average Growth Rates 🌱

The growth rate of Rhizophora species can vary significantly, typically ranging from 1 to 3 meters (3 to 10 feet) per year under optimal conditions. This variability is influenced by several key factors.

Factors Affecting Growth Rate 🌍

  • Soil Type: Nutrient-rich soils are crucial for promoting faster growth. The more nutrients available, the more robust the tree's development.
  • Salinity Levels: Moderate salinity levels can enhance growth, while extreme salinity may hinder it. Finding the right balance is essential for thriving mangroves.

Growth Rate Comparisons πŸ“Š

Growth rates can differ widely based on habitat conditions. For instance, trees in nutrient-dense coastal areas often outpace those in less favorable environments.

Time to Reach Full Size

🌱 Growth Timeline

Reaching full size is a journey for Rhizophora species, typically taking between 10 to 20 years to achieve their maximum height and width. This timeframe can vary significantly based on several influencing factors.

⏳ Factors Influencing Time to Maturity

Environmental conditions play a crucial role in this growth timeline. When conditions are optimalβ€”think nutrient-rich soil and adequate waterβ€”growth can accelerate, allowing these trees to reach maturity faster.

Species differences also contribute to the variability in growth rates. Some Rhizophora species are naturally predisposed to mature more quickly than others, making them ideal choices for specific planting scenarios.
